386 W Prospect St, Ventura, CA 93001-1880
PO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 93001:
183 E Vince St, Ventura, CA 93001 |
651 E Thompson Blvd, Ventura, CA 93001 |
2324 Hyland Ave, Ventura, CA 93001 |
177 1/2 Jordan Ave, Ventura, CA 93001 |
225 E Shoshone St, Ventura, CA 93001 |